Olsen Actuators & Drives appoints Ian Walch as Managing Director

Olsen Actuators & Drives has announced the appointment of Ian Walch as its new Managing Director.

Image courtesy Olsen Actuators & Drives

Piers Olsen has now moved to Chairman and will continue to focus on business development and strategic markets and applications.

With extensive experience across a range of sectors including aerospace, defence and industrial, Ian Walsh (above) has joined the team with a proven track record of restructuring, turn around and business growth

Ian’s vision for Olsen Actuators & Drives includes increasing revenue, developing skilled 'UK Engineering and Manufacturing' capability and enhancing the company's reputation in the market by providing safety-critical actuation.

Ian said: “It is an exciting opportunity to be part of the Olsen business providing cutting-edge Electrical Actuation solutions and products into blue chip clients across the world.”

Piers Olsen said: “We fully support Ian with this opportunity and look forward to working with him to ensure success in this endeavour.”
